Accommodate

/əˈkɒmədeɪt/
To provide space or a place for someone or something.

Etymology:

etymology
The word accommodate originates from the Latin accommodatus, past participle of accommodare, which means to make fit, adapt, from ad- (to) + commodus (convenient, suitable).
